Recently, media personality Bill Maher made uncharacteristic remarks on a podcast episode with Cheryl Hines, wife of HHS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r., remarked at the kindness of republicans compared to democrats.
The exchange began with Maher recounting a recent dinner with President Trump, where, despite arguments, Maher maintained “[Trump] does not want to cut me off, which is not something I can say about the left.”
“Republicans have been very kind to me, from the beginning. Even from the beginning, when Bobby was running as a Democrat, they weren’t mean, and they never have been. And I can’t say that for the Democrats,” Hines stated.
Maher is not known as a glowing supporter of the Republican Party. Though he has also criticized various wings of the democratic party, he is on the record saying that he believes the republicans are “even worse.” Additionally, just three weeks ago Maher slammed Trump for his ballroom renovations, accusing him of dictatorial intentions.
Yet, even to Maher, the truth is undeniable. Republicans, traditionally considered more judgemental and hardline, has recently become the kinder option.
“I’m not going to pretend I don’t notice, how different they are, how mean they’ve become,” Maher says about the democrats.
Democratic Senator John Fetterman agrees.
Fetterman defended similar remarks he made in his book “Unfettered” on CNN. “I’ve drunk deeply of the venom of both the left and the right. And I can confirm the most poisonous, the bitterest, is from the far left.”
In his experience, the right will call names, but the left wishes death upon you.
